Embark on a journey to enhance your understanding of the pivotal transition from K-12 education to post-school endeavors for individuals with an Individualized Education Program (IEP). Delve into the intricacies of transition planning mandated by the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A 2004), which is designed to facilitate a seamless shift into post-school activities.

Join our enlightening session to unravel the distinctions between state and federal transition requirements integrated into the IEP to bolster your path to post-school success. We will navigate through crucial topics, including TAC 89.1055, the requirements between age 14 and 16, fostering self-determination, comprehensive transition assessments, crafting impactful IEP goals, strategic courses of study, demystifying the Summary of Performance (SOP), and articulating effective post-secondary goals.
